The Black Map 80: Miscreant from Nottingham!

Originally formed by vocalist Harvey Jaffrey and former From Sorrow To Serenity guitarist Kieran Smith in 2015, Nottingham quartet Miscreant dropped their debut EP “Living Death” a year later with “Bitter Regrets” featuring a guest vocal appearance from Justin Johnson of Detroit Michigan Nu-Metalcore crew Gift Giver.
